Transaction 3099932a9850eeb2d30e642abf9a0700f909d9cc997bb5e79959f34151847236
1 Input
2 Outputs
- 3099932a9850eeb2d30e642abf9a0700f909d9cc997bb5e79959f34151847236:0
- 3099932a9850eeb2d30e642abf9a0700f909d9cc997bb5e79959f34151847236:1
value 370951
address 38sZGscGSHyFRq63wKyWqXbb6vH3mSWQEa
value 460000
address 3M7HUYNNuEy7rF4VQZzgiH5vjWCyiJG8tp